Transaction bb66fc864961df3e2356e7b0ae29430e960b3b6fc01b6437225ec560864f7832
1 Input
1 Output
-
bb66fc864961df3e2356e7b0ae29430e960b3b6fc01b6437225ec560864f7832:0
- value
- 452080
- script pubkey
- OP_0 OP_PUSHBYTES_20 1faea2a22656752987e61ce6cc9d09a75030ae2c
- address
- bc1qr7h29g3x2e6jnplxrnnve8gf5agrpt3vgphe3u